🌿 A washed coffee grown in a hand-built forest in the Ecuadorian desert

Farm: Las Terrazas del Pisque
Producer: Arnaud Causse
Region: Pichincha, Quito, Ecuador
Altitude: 2000 m
Species: Arabica
Variety: Red Caturra
Harvest: —
Harvesting Method: Hand-picked
Process: Washed
Drying: 8–12 days in shade after 48h fermentation (24h immersed)


About this coffee

What’s the best way to grow coffee in a forest? Start by building the forest yourself. That’s exactly what Arnaud Causse did at Las Terrazas del Pisque — a pioneering farm established in a dry, desert-like zone on the Pacific side of the Andes. A trained agronomist, Arnaud planted over 25 species of trees, including ingas, lemon, and avocado, to create the perfect shaded microclimate for specialty coffee.

No pesticides are used here. Instead, coffee plants are treated with essential oils of lavender, marigold, and rosemary — all produced on-site. Flowering plants attract bees for honey production, leguminous crops enrich the soil, and fruit trees provide food and habitat for birds that naturally control pests.

This Red Caturra lot — a natural mutation of Bourbon — thrives at 2000 metres above sea level. After careful handpicking, the beans undergo a 24-hour dry fermentation, followed by 24 hours in water, then slow drying under shade. The result is a refined, layered cup with notes of hazelnut, citrus, honey and floral undertones.
